Apple Watch sensitivity changed with WatchOS 4?
Ive just updated to WatchOS 4 and now my screen won’t work with screen protector on. I restarted Watch with no success. Is there any way to change screen sensitivity?

After a few hours of messing with my watch on this issue, I have discovered what the problem is. Watch with cover on, off my wrist, works fine. Put watch back on my wrists, nope! Went into Watch then Passcode and turned off wrist detection and YES! Fixed! However, certain things may need wrist detection turned on.... For now, until they fix the bug, this will do! Good luck!
